Assessing Your Home's Solar Potential
Prior to diving right into solar panel installment, you need to evaluate your home's solar possibility. Begin by checking your roof's orientation and incline; south-facing roofings usually record one of the most sunlight.
Seek any obstructions, like trees or tall buildings, that might cast shadows on your panels. These can dramatically minimize energy production. Consider your neighborhood environment too; bright locations generate much better outcomes than constantly over cast areas.
Next off, assess your power demands and use patterns to identify how many panels you'll call for. You could additionally wish to utilize on the internet solar calculators or speak with an expert to obtain a clearer picture.

Panel Efficiency Scores
As you check out the world of solar panels, understanding panel performance rankings is crucial for making an informed decision. These scores show exactly how efficiently a panel converts sunlight into usable electrical power. The greater the performance, the extra energy you'll produce from a smaller space. A lot of property panels vary from 15% to 22% performance.
When selecting your panels, consider your energy requirements and offered roofing system room. If you have actually limited area, opting for higher-efficiency panels could be helpful. Nonetheless, if you have ample roofing area, lower-efficiency panels might be sufficient.
Installation Type Options
Selecting the appropriate installment type for solar panels can dramatically affect your system's performance and performance. You'll typically encounter two main options: roof-mounted and ground-mounted systems.
Roof-mounted panels are often the best selection for homeowners, as they use existing room and can be cheaper to mount. Nevertheless, if your roof isn't ideal-- probably as a result of shading or structural concerns-- ground-mounted systems may be the much better option.
They enable optimal positioning, making best use of sunlight exposure. In addition, you can adjust their angle to improve effectiveness.
Before determining, take into consideration elements like available room, budget plan, and neighborhood guidelines. By examining these alternatives very carefully, you'll guarantee your solar panel installation fulfills your power needs effectively.
Visual Considerations
While capability is critical, visual appeals shouldn't be ignored when picking solar panels for your home. You want panels that not only job efficiently however likewise match your home's design.
Consider the color and size of the solar panels; black panels commonly mix flawlessly with dark roofings, while blue panels could stick out much more. Look into options like building-integrated photovoltaics (BIPV) that replace standard roofing products, using a smooth look.
You can likewise check out solar tiles, which mimic basic roofing and can boost visual allure. Do not fail to remember to assess the layout and placement of the panels to make best use of both effectiveness and aesthetic harmony.
Inevitably, striking the ideal balance in between efficiency and appearances will make your solar investment extra gratifying.
